Material weakness Filing comparison

VEEA INC. reported internal control effective again after a material weakness

Material weakness in internal control Internal control reported effective

The weakness was first reported on 2022-04-22 — 1454 days and 4 annual reports before this one.

In making that assessment, management used the criteria based on the framework set forth in Internal Control-Integrated Framework 2013 issued by the Committee of Sponsoring Organizations of the Treadway Commission (“COSO”). Based on its assessment, our management concluded that, as of December 31, 2025, our internal control over financial reporting was effective. The rules of the SEC do not require, and this Annual Report does not include an attestation report of our independent registered public accounting firm…

Late filing elevated Filing comparison

VEEA INC. told the SEC it could not file its annual report on time

Does not expect a significant change in results. 1 day past the statutory due date.

The Registrant is unable to file its Annual Report on Form 10-K for the fiscal year ended December 31, 2025 (the “Form 10-K”) within the prescribed time period without unreasonable effort or expense. The delay is primarily due to the recent transition in the Company’s outsourced corporate accounting services provider. The newly appointed accounting advisors are performing a comprehensive review of the Company’s historical accounting records, finalizing the compilation, and reviewing subsequent events that occurred in the first quarter of 2026. This review has required additional time for the Company to compile and analyze supporting documentation and has also extended the time necessary for…
